| As an essential part of Intelligent Transportation System,Vehicular Ad Hoc Network is an important extension of Internet of things in transportation.In VANET,Road-Side Units are responsible for assisting vehicle to access the internet and obtain multimedia information.However,due to the limited channel bandwidth and the frequent changes of the net,work topology,it’s hard to respond vehicles’ requests in time.Based on research,it is found that caching popular content in RSU and designing efficient data sheduling can effectively reduce the access delay of users and improve the service efficiency and quality of system.Therefore,the cooperative caching and data sheduling for RSU in VANET are studied in this paper.Firstly,this paper gives a detailed introduction to the caching algorithm in Information Centric Networking.Then combining the local feature of users’ requests with the matching character of cache redundancy and content popularity,this paper proposes a probability caching algorithm with cache-allocation-aware.The simulation results show that the proposed algorithm effectively improves the cache hit ratio and decreases the average reponse hops.Secondly,this paper briefs the SDN architecture and the current research situation of data sheduling in VANET.Then,based on the analysis of factors affecting system service efficiency,this paper proposes a data sheduling algorithm based on SDN architecture.Simulation results indicate that the proposed algorithm effectively improves the service efficiency and quality. |
